Mahabharata Udyoga Parva – सव्यसाची पुरॊ ऽभयेति दरॊणानीकाय भारत

Shloka (श्लोक)

सव्यसाची पुरॊ ऽभयेति दरॊणानीकाय भारत
संसक्तं सात्यकिं जञात्वा बहुभिः कुरुपुंगवैः
